Factfile on previous World Cup finals ahead of Sunday's at Soccer City between The Netherlands and Spain:

HT Image
HT Image

The 18 previous finals:

30/07/1930 Montevideo URUGUAY 4 Argentina 2
10/06/1934 Rome ITALY 2 Czechoslovakia 1 after extra-time
19/06/1938 Paris ITALy 4 Hungary 2
16/07/1950 Rio de Janeiro URUGUAY 2 Brazil 1
04/07/1954 Berne WEST GERMANY 3 Hungary 2
29/06/1958 Stockholm BRAZIL 5 Sweden 2
17/06/1962 Santiago BRAZIL 2 Czechoslovakia 1
30/07/1966 London ENGLAND 4 West Germany 2 after extra-time
21/06/1970 Mexico BRAZIL 4 Italy 1
07/07/1974 Munich (GER) WEST GERMANY 2 Netherlands 1
25/06/1978 Buenos Aires ARGENTINA 3 Netherlands 1 after extra-time
11/07/1982 Madrid ITALY 3 West Germany 1
29/06/1986 Mexico ARGENTINA 3 West Germany 2
08/07/1990 Rome WEST GERMANY 1 Argentina 0
17/07/1994 Pasadena (USA) BRAZIL 0 Italy 0 Brazil won 3-2 on penalties
12/07/1998 Paris FRANCE 3 Brazil 0
30/06/2002 Yokohama (JPN) BRAZIL 2 Germany 0
09/07/2006 Berlin (GER) ITALY 1 France 1 Italy won 5-3 on penalties

Finals decided after 90 minutes - 13
Finals decided after extra-time - 3 (1934, 1966, 1978)
Finals decided after penalties - 2 (1994, 2006)

World Cup wins: Brazil (5), Italy (4), Germany/West Germany (3), Argentina (2), Uruguay (2), England (1), France (1)

World Cup final appearances (including 2010): Brazil (7), Germany/West Germany (7), Italy (6), Argentina (4), Uruguay (2), Netherlands (3), Hungary (2), Czechoslovakia (2), France (2), England (1), Sweden (1), Spain (1).

Finals with no European teams: 1930, 1950

Finals with no South American teams: 1934, 1938, 1954, 1966, 1974, 1982, 2006, 2010

Total number of goals scored: 69 (29 in first half, 35 in second half, 5 in extra-time), average of 3.83 per final.

Penalties: 4 (2 in 1974, 1 in 1990, 1 in 2006)

Most goals in a final: 7, Brazil v Sweden (5-2) in 1958

Fewest goals in a final: 0, Brazil 0 Italy 0 in 1994

Total number of spectators: 1,467,321, an average of 81,517 per final.

Biggest attendance: 174,000, for Uruguay v Brazil (2-1) in Maracana Stadium, Rio de Janeiro in 1950

Smallest attendance: 45,000, for Italy v Hungary (4-2) at Colombes (Paris) in 1938
Total number of players in finals: 387

A total of 51 players have taken part in two finals. One player has taken part in three - Cafu of Brazil in 1994, 1998 and 2002).

Number of scorers: 54

Two goals in a final: 7 (Rahn/GER, Breitner/GER, Piola/ITA, Colaussi/ITA, Kempes/ARG, Zidane/FRA, Ronaldo/BRA)

Three goals in a final: 3 (Hurst/ENG, Pele/BRA, Vava/BRA)

Goals in two different finals: 3 (Breitner/GER, Pele/BRA, Vava/BRA, Zidane/FRA)

Players who have won more than one World Cup: 21

Pele (BRA/1958, 1962, 1970), Castilho, Bellini, Gilmar, Didi, Zagallo, Djalma Santos, Zozimo, Garrincha, Nilton Santos, Mauro, Zito, Vava, Pepe (BRA/1958, 1962), Ferrari, Meazza, Monzeglio, Massetti (ITA/1934, 1938), Passarella (ARG/1978, 1986), Cafu, Ronaldo (BRA/1994, 2002).

World Cup winner as player and coach: 2 (Zagallo/BRA, Beckenbauer/GER)

Youngest player in a final: 17 years and 249 days - Pele/BRA en 1958

Oldest player in a final: 40 years and 133 days - Zoff/ITA en 1982

Number of yellow cards: 39

Number of red cards: 4 (Monzon, Dezotti/ARG in 1990; Desailly/FRA in 1998, Zidane 2006)
